代理服务器的原理与应用

在现代网络环境中,代理服务器是保障网络稳定性和安全性的重要工具之一,它的主要功能是提供路由、过滤和缓存等服务,为用户或应用程序提供虚拟化的访问网络环境,本文将详细介绍代理服务器的工作原理及其在实际中的应用。

什么是代理服务器?

代理服务器,也称为网关或者中间人服务器,是一种软件系统,它在网络通信过程中起到桥梁的作用,它的工作原理是将用户的请求转发给正确的服务器,然后返回用户的原始数据,这样可以避免各个客户端直接进行通信,从而提高网络的效率和稳定性。

代理服务器的原理

代理服务器的基本工作原理基于“源IP地址+目的IP地址”的模式,当一个客户端向代理服务器发送请求时,其源IP地址会被转换成代理服务器的公有IP地址,代理服务器收到请求后,会根据源IP地址来选择合适的服务器进行响应,代理服务器也会记录下每个客户端的请求信息,以便后续的查询和分析。

代理服务器的应用

1、网络隔离:通过设置代理服务器,可以将多个客户端分隔开来,防止同一个客户端与其他客户端进行频繁的数据交互,从而降低网络流量和延迟。

2、数据过滤:代理服务器可以通过IP地址、端口号、协议类型等多种方式来过滤掉不符合预期的服务,保护网络的安全性。

3、负载均衡:在高并发的情况下,通过设置代理服务器,可以将请求分散到多台服务器上,从而实现负载均衡,提高系统的性能。

4、安全防护:代理服务器可以作为防火墙的一部分,对非法访问进行阻断,保证网络的安全性。

代理服务器在现代网络环境中发挥着重要的作用,不仅可以提供高效的服务,还可以保护网络的安全性,无论是在企业还是个人网络中,都应当合理地配置和使用代理服务器。

发表评论

评论列表

还没有评论,快来说点什么吧~